Title: 117 Engine question.
Post by: Road G on March 18, 2021, 02:59:19 PM
I bought a new CVO Road Glide and as most know it has a 117 engine. My question is, do the CVO engines have anything special inside? I mean are there better cams or so on that make it a better engine that say a stock 114? I assume that it is just a stock 117 engine, but really cannot find any data on the subject. Thanks for any help with info.
Title: Re: 117 Engine question.
Post by: FLSTFI Dave on March 19, 2021, 06:46:26 AM
The 117 CVO engine uses a different cam than the 114.  It has a bit more low end torque.  CVO is a black granite color, non CVO is black.

Other than that they are pretty much the same.
Title: Re: 117 Engine question.
Post by: RivRaptor on March 20, 2021, 02:27:27 PM
To add to what Dave said, the 114 /117 CVOs have one extra plate in the clutch and more amp output from the charging system.  Now that 114's are standard in other models I'm not sure what carried over from my 17' 114ci CVO.
